I'm a native, born and raised. I've seen Miami grow into the international hotspot it's known for. Depending on where you live, transportation may not be that good, but there's never a shortage of things to do and see. It's gotten really expensive to live here, but you can't beat the food, people, events, water, and overall vibe. My advice is to EXPLORE. There are many neighborhoods and communities in Miami that are unknown jewels. It's up to you to find them and your tribe. If you're looking for a cultural explosion, you'll find it here.

Frequently Asked Questions about Miami

How much are Studio apartments in Miami?

There are currently 6,388 Studio Apartments in Miami with rent ranges from $1,000 to $10,394 with an average price of $2,326.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Miami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Miami ranges from $200 to $17,607 with an average monthly rent of $2,501.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Miami c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Miami range from $330 to $29,862.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,171.

How expensive are Miami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 1,502 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Miami on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$924 to $30,000 - averaging $4,346 for the location.
